Output e01e0eb75965ecd40dfa4052e8980c3565fc04a8ffe04f19ddd048f9717832da:0

value
3128686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 379dde045e185d847cf34a88ff5fa92e92680ce2 OP_EQUAL
address
36m6CuMmLSUfUXScEURQbPXiQnREmBuNPu
transaction
e01e0eb75965ecd40dfa4052e8980c3565fc04a8ffe04f19ddd048f9717832da
confirmations
84706
spent
true